BuildPulse is a software development company based in Seattle, Washington. It offers an affordable building analytics service that provides actionable insights across building automation systems, covering both legacy and newer installations. The service aims to help anticipate issues, identify areas to save money, and reduce time spent searching for problems so teams can focus on resolving them.

The company operates with a small team. In November 2018, BuildPulse was acquired by CopperTree Analytics, a worldwide leader in building data and energy analytics software.
